Cube Hexagonal DissectionA cube can be dissected using a hexagon that contains the midpoints of the central edges of the cube when viewed along one space diagonal. It is simple and mathematically interesting. Try to find the area and perimeter of the hexagonal cross section. How about the Dihedral angle between the hexagonal plane to the cube base? To make it playful, I added a slide so one can keep the two pieces together. The whole cube can be printed in one piece at 0.2mm or less. The cube is 50mm^3.
